13 Example Sentences Showcasing the Meaning of 'Peckish'

Despite being peckish, the author continued to write, determined to finish the captivating story before dinner.

The detective's focus wavered as he became peckish while working on solving the mysterious case.

The chef, despite feeling peckish, meticulously prepared a delicious feast for the grand banquet.

The chef prepared a variety of appetizers for the guests who were feeling peckish before the main course.

After the performance, the actors were peckish and shared a late-night meal at a local diner.

The marathon reading session left the book club members feeling peckish, prompting them to order a variety of snacks.

The software engineer, immersed in coding, only realized he was peckish when his stomach rumbled loudly in the quiet office.

The historian, engrossed in research, powered through the afternoon feeling peckish, eager to uncover new insights.

The marathon runners were peckish after crossing the finish line and replenished with energy bars.

At the botanical garden, visitors often become peckish and enjoy a light meal at the on-site restaurant.

The architect, engrossed in designing a skyscraper, became peckish but decided to skip lunch to meet the project deadline.

The scientist, deep in the laboratory experiment, almost forgot about feeling peckish until a colleague offered a snack.

The coding team, working on a tight deadline, ordered a variety of snacks when they started feeling peckish.
